Security Bulletin
This security bulletin contains one medium risk vulnerability.
EUVDB-ID: #VU119229
Risk: Medium
CVSSv4.0: 1.3 [C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:L/UI:N/VC:N/VI:N/VA:L/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:U/U:Green]
CVE-ID: CVE-2025-66552
CWE-ID:
CWE-778 - Insufficient Logging
Exploit availability: No
D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a remote attacker to compromise the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to the admin_audit does not log all actions on files in groupfolders. A remote user can per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
MitigationInstall updates from vendor's website.
Vulnerable software versionsNextcloud Server: 30.0.0 - 31.0.0
Nextcloud Enterprise Server: 30.0.0 - 31.0.0
